High Cost of Raising Children in Italy Drives Down Birth Rate
A Milanese family can expect to spend 30% of its disposable income on raising a child to age 18, totaling €156,000, an increase of 12% since 2022, impacting birth rates.

Parenthood and Well-being in Europe: A Cross-National Study
A University of Cologne study of over 43,000 people across 30 European countries reveals that having children increases a sense of meaning in life but decreases overall life satisfaction, with Scandinavian countries showing the least disparity and Germany needing improved family support.

Parenthood Shown to Have Neuroprotective Effects, Challenging Economic Arguments Against Childbearing
A study of nearly 40,000 individuals in the UK Biobank found a correlation between raising children and improved brain connectivity and function later in life, suggesting a neuroprotective effect of parenthood that challenges economic arguments against having children in aging societies.
